ARVN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2021 in Review

199 of the 6,498 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Arvinas (ARVN) for Q4 2021, worth a combined $3.69B — up 1.4% from $3.64B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 35 funds closed out of ARVN and 32 opened new positions — a net loss of 3 holders — while 60 trimmed existing stakes and 81 added.

The largest buyer was T. Rowe Price Associates, adding an estimated $28.8M. The largest seller was Morgan Stanley, cutting an estimated $40.4M.
